South African telecom provider serving 7.7 million confirms data leak following cyberattack


Cell C, South Africa’s fourth-largest telecom provider, confirmed a cyberattack by the RansomHouse group, leaking 2TB of customer data. The compromised info includes names, contact details, banking, and ID numbers. Cell C is working with cybersecurity experts and advising affected individuals to be cautious of identity theft. RansomHouse has targeted other major organizations in the past.
